Most wounds heal with a minimum of care, like keeping it clean and protected. Non-healing wounds, on the other hand, don’t heal themselves, even with moderate care. While you may face daily health risks of cuts, scratches or bug bites, non-healing wounds often result from a chronic underlying health condition, such as:
- Poor circulation from heart condition, vascular and/or pulmonary disease
- A weakened immune system
- Diabetes
- Thyroid conditions
- Cancer
Wounds that don’t heal over 4-6 weeks diminish your quality of life and can lead to more serious medical conditions. If you develop a non-healing wound, you may have a health issue that’s uncontrolled or undiagnosed, decreasing your body’s natural ability to heal itself.
